Sure. 'War and Peace' by Leo Tolstoy is a great example. It's a very long novel that tells the story of Russian society during the Napoleonic Wars. There are numerous characters and plotlines that span across different social classes and families.

Some popular ones include 'The Imitation Game' and 'Selma'. 'The Imitation Game' is about Alan Turing and his work during World War II, while 'Selma' focuses on the civil rights marches led by Martin Luther King Jr. Both are inspired by actual events and people.
